Budget 2019: Defence allocation disappoints military

Union Budget has allocated Rs 3.18 lakh crore for defence.The allocation is estimated to be at around 1.6% of the GDP which experts have said is the lowest since the 1962 war with China. U.S. curbs,Chabahar downgrade choke Indo-Afghan trade

The government in its Budget has allocated ₹45 crore for India’s building activities in the port of Chabahar Iran.This is a reduction from the previous year’s allocation of ₹150 crore. Pink City Jaipur gets UNESCO World Heritage tag

The United Nations Educational,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) has added Jaipur to its World Heritage List. This announcement was made during the 43rd session of the UNESCO World Heritage Committee in Azerbaijan. AI tool helps astronomers identify galaxy clusters quickly

Researchers have developed an artificial intelligence powered tool called as “Deep-CEE” to identify galaxy clusters quickly. Galaxy clusters are some of the most massive structures in the cosmos but despite being millions of light years across,they can still be hard to spot. Soon, contraceptives for animals

The Ministry of Environment,Forest and Climate Change (MOEFCC) has launched a project for undertaking ‘immunocontraceptive measures’ for population management of four species of wild animals. The four species of wild animals are (a)elephant (b)wild boar (c)monkey and (d)blue bull(Nilgai).The project will begin in Uttarakhand and then be extended to other States. IITM Pune: Predicting heat waves three weeks in advance

Researchers at Pune’s Indian Institute of Tropical Meteorology(IITM) has developed a real time prediction system of heat waves two to three weeks in advance. The prediction system has shown promise in indicating the date of onset, duration and demise of heat waves with a small spatial and temporal error.
